Wu'an is witnessing a transformative leap in its traditional steel sector, driven by technological innovation and intelligent manufacturing upgrades. The Ministry of Industry and Information Technology has recently publicized its 2025 list of exemplary artificial intelligence application cases, with two local enterprises, Xinjin Steel and Xinxing Pipes, securing spots among only eight high-quality selections province-wide. In another milestone, Xinjin Steel's three core products have passed the initial Hebei Province high-tech product certification for 2026, earning three certificates at once and showcasing substantial R&D outcomes that underscore the industry's shift toward high-end development.
Today, technical renovations and smart upgrades dominate the agenda for steel companies in Wu'an, steering the sector toward a new growth trajectory focused on technology, quality, and innovation. Supported by policy incentives, talent development, and digital empowerment, the city is carving a path that prioritizes high-end, intelligent, and green transformation for its traditional industries.
Where to begin: a collaborative push between government and business
The local government has zeroed in on the pain points of steel industry transformation, proactively streamlining services across multiple departments to ease the burden on corporate innovation and channel benefits directly to enterprises. By coordinating efforts from science, industry, taxation, and administrative approval bodies, Wu'an has rolled out a suite of support measures, including tax deductions for R&D expenses and preferential treatments for high-tech firms, effectively lowering the cost of innovation. Special subsidies are being directed toward technical upgrades and new product development, encouraging companies to invest boldly in R&D. A tiered cultivation ledger for tech-driven enterprises enables precise, company-by-company service, with 22 firms already recognized as innovative small and medium-sized enterprises in Hebei Province in early 2026, steadily expanding the reserve of innovative businesses and fueling long-term momentum for high-quality growth.
In parallel, Wu'an is building platforms for innovation incubation, having established two provincial-level incubation bases, including the Wu'an Industrial Park Entrepreneurship Service Center and the Wu'an Innovation and Entrepreneurship Incubation Base, alongside one municipal-level base. The Industrial Park center is now aiming for national-level status, providing a nurturing environment for startups and small enterprises to thrive.
University-industry collaboration unlocks sector potential
Talent serves as the core engine for industrial upgrading. This June, Jinding Steel signed an agreement with the University of Science and Technology Beijing and the Handan Steel Industry Innovation Research Institute to validate and promote a "smart blast furnace" technology. This project leverages AI large models to create a closed-loop intelligent control system, transitioning blast furnace operations from traditional experience-based methods to smart, automated processes. It represents a landmark achievement in Wu'an's model of enterprise-university-research collaboration.
In recent years, Wu'an has focused on both attracting external expertise and nurturing local talent. The city has established platforms for university-industry collaboration, regularly bringing in specialists from academia and research institutes to tackle technical challenges on-site. So far this year, 34 technical exchange sessions have been held, leading to substantive partnerships between key steelmakers like Xinjin, Jinan, Jinding, Taihang, and Xinhui with research bodies, effectively translating cutting-edge research into practical production solutions and strengthening corporate competitiveness.
At the same time, Wu'an is tapping into local talent potential by guiding companies to improve internal training systems. Initiatives like mentorship programs and distinct career pathways in management, technology, and skilled trades are building a robust talent pipeline. Jinding Steel has established its own skills training academy and introduced an internal talent review mechanism that breaks traditional promotion barriers, allowing frontline workers to boost their pay directly through technical innovations, process optimizations, or product improvements, spurring widespread enthusiasm for skill development and creative problem-solving.
Digital transformation accelerates high-end manufacturing
Step inside Taihang Steel's ESP automated workshop, and you'll see a globally leading endless rolling line operating at full capacity, driving a revolution in efficient manufacturing. "The entire line eliminates the need for reheating, producing ultra-thin strip steel at just 0.7 millimeters from molten metal in only seven minutes, cutting energy consumption by 40% and dramatically boosting output efficiency," says Li Yang, plant manager. This state-of-the-art line has enabled the company's high-end thin plates to earn EU CE certification, with exports reaching Europe and Southeast Asia, elevating both product quality and market position.
AI integration, machine automation, and digital oversight are now standard practices across Wu'an's industrial landscape, with steel and equipment manufacturers embracing smart upgrades across the board. Jinding Steel has been named a national-level benchmark smart factory, using fully digitalized processes to enable flexible, customized steel production. Xinjin Steel has deployed an industrial digital twin platform, applying AI algorithms to precisely manage energy consumption. Gongying Equipment Manufacturing has paired fully automated molding lines with RGV transfer systems, creating a seamless "smart artery" that significantly boosts productivity. Collectively, Wu'an has developed and certified 38 vertical large models and 35 intelligent agents, ranking first in Handan City and highlighting the sector's notable progress in digitalization and smart transformation.
From a past focused on output volume and scale to today's emphasis on technology, quality, and intelligence, Wu'an's steel industry has fundamentally shifted gears. It is now steadily advancing toward the higher echelons of the industrial, supply, and value chains. This traditional industrial city, powered by innovation and smart manufacturing, is revitalizing its legacy sectors and injecting sustained momentum into regional industrial growth.
